SMU doubles Moncton 4-2 in women's hockey action

SMU doubles Moncton 4-2 in women's hockey action

(Moncton, NB) Saint Mary's University Huskies (11-1-0=22pts, 1st position) scored three goals in a span of 8 minutes in the third period to break up a 1-1 tie game and beat Université de Moncton Aigles Bleues (2-9-1=5pts, 8th position), 4-2 on Sunday in an Atlantic University Sport women's hockey game at the J.-Louis-Lévesque Arena.  

Shea Demale, at 8:42, Subway player of the game Miranda Hatt, at 11:43 and Brooke Murphy, at 16:10, got the third period markers for the visitors. Ellen Laurence, on the power play in the first, had the first goal. Katherine Dubuc (Catherine Longchamps, Samantha Mclaughlin), in the middle period on the power play and Aude Massé (Jennifer Arsenault), at the end of the game, picked up the Moncton goals. Audrey Berthiaume handled 39 shots, including 15 in the first and 14 in the third period, for the loss. Rebecca Clark registered the win with 14 saves. Moncton was 1 for 3 on the power play and Saint Mary's, 1 for 5.

The Blue and Gold will hold two home games on the weekend. They host University of New Brunswick Reds, Friday and the Mount Allison University Mounties, Saturday, both games at 7p.m. the J.-Louis-Lévesque Arena.

Saint Mary's will host UNB Saturday at 3 at the Dauphinee Centre.
